Unu Pro 4kW - Specifications & Review

MakeUnu
ModelPro 4kW
PriceEuro 4299. MSRP depends on country, taxes, accessories, etc.
Year2023

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rontbrakesSingle disc
FrontsuspensionTelescopic fork
Fronttyre110/70-10
RearbrakesSingle disc
RearsuspensionMonoshock
Reartyre110/70-10
SeatDual seat
WheelsAluminium rims. Heidenau K80 SR tires.

Engine & Transmission

CoolingsystemAir
EmissiondetailsNo direct emissions
EnginedetailsBosch brushless rear wheel electric motor
EnginetypeElectric
Gearbox1-speed
Power5.4 HP (3.9 kW))
Topspeed45.0 km/h (28.0 mph)

Other Specifications

CarryingcapacityLockable helmet attachment for two helmets. Luggage rack.
ColoroptionsGreen, Black, Grey
CommentsOne or two LG Lithium-ion rechargeable batteries. 7 hours charging. Recovery of braking energy. Range 50 to 100 km. Various motor and battery options. German brand.
InstrumentsLCD instruments
StarterElectric

Physical Measures & Capacities

Overallheight1050 mm (41.3 inches)
Overalllength1820 mm (71.7 inches)
Overallwidth700 mm (27.6 inches)
Seatheight730 mm (28.7 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.
Weightincloilgasetc84.0 kg (185.2 pounds)

About Unu

Country of Origin: Germany
Founder: Pascal Blum, Elias Atahi, Mathieu Caudal
Best Known For: Design-led electric scooters with removable batteries and app integration

Company History

Unu pairs minimalist industrial design with apartment-friendly removable batteries, targeting European city dwellers. The scooters focus on intuitive UX—clear displays, simple throttles, connected theft alerts—and dealer-light service via partner workshops. Historically, Unu reflects the European D2C e-mobility model: thoughtful design, honest range, and logistics that make EVs feel like consumer electronics—predictable and friendly.
